What Is Double Cream Called In Nz? [Solved]

The equivalent in New Zealand is the regular fresh cream sold in supermarkets. Double cream has a higher fat content – around 48-50 per cent, and it’s not commonly available here. Crème fraîche, on the other hand, is cream that’s had a culture added, making it slightly sour in flavour.
